Главная / Программирование /
Язык программирования Perl / Тест 17
Язык программирования Perl - тест 17
Упражнение 1:
Номер 1
Что такое IP-адрес?
Ответ:
 (1) идентификации хоста в сети 
 (2) уникальное название ресурса, например, http://www.intuit.ru 
 (3) уникальный номер устройства, присваиваемый производителем 
Номер 2
Что такое номер порта?
Ответ:
 (1) число для привязки поступающих данных к программе на хосте  
 (2) последовательность из 4-х чисел для идентификации хоста в сети 
 (3) порядковый номер пакета данных, пересылаемого по сети 
Номер 3
Что такое хост?
Ответ:
 (1) компьютер или другое устройство, подключенное к сети 
 (2) сетевая программа, работающая на конкретном компьютере 
 (3) логический канал связи между сетевыми программами 
Упражнение 2:
Номер 1
Для чего используется протокол TCP?
Ответ:
 (1) для обмена небольшими независимыми блоками данных  
 (2) для обмена сигналами с устройствами в компьютерных сетях 
 (3) для передачи по сети упорядоченного потока данных 
Номер 2
Для чего используется протокол UDP?
Ответ:
 (1) для передачи по сети упорядоченного потока данных 
 (2) для обмена небольшими независимыми блоками данных 
 (3) для непосредственного доступа к ящику на почтовом сервере 
Номер 3
Для чего используется протокол IP?
Ответ:
 (1) для транспортировки пакетов данных от отправителя получателю 
 (2) для поиска физического адреса устройства по IP-адресу 
 (3) для управления компьютерными сетями 
Упражнение 3:
Номер 1
Для организации обмена файлами предназначен класс...
Ответ:
 (1) ... Net::FTP
 
 (2) ... Net::SSH
 
 (3) ... Net::VNC
 
Номер 2
Для отправки электронной почты применяется класс...
Ответ:
 (1) ... Net::POP3
 
 (2) ... Net::SMTP
 
 (3) ... Net::SNMP
 
Номер 3
Протокол управления сетью реализован в классе...
Ответ:
 (1) ... Net::NNTP
 
 (2) ... Net::SMTP
 
 (3) ... Net::SNMP
 
Номер 4
Для получения почтовых сообщений используется класс...
Ответ:
 (1) ... Net::POP3
 
 (2) ... Net::SMTP
 
 (3) ... Net::XMPP
 
Упражнение 4:
Номер 1
Для обращения к программе на этом же компьютере используется...
Ответ:
 (1) ... специальный IP-адрес 127.0.0.1 
 (2) ... специальный IP-адрес 10.0.0.1 
 (3) ... специальный IP-адрес 192.168.0.1 
Номер 2
Каждый сокет определяется...
Ответ:
 (1) ... адресом хоста, номером порта и используемым протоколом 
 (2) ... адресом хоста и номером порта 
 (3) ... только адресом хоста 
Номер 3
Класс Net::FTP реализует...
Ответ:
 (1) FTP-клиента 
 (2) FTP-сервер 
 (3) и клиента, и сервер для работы по FTP 
Упражнение 5:
Номер 1
Для определения IP-адреса компьютера по его имени служит...
Ответ:
 (1) ... встроенная функция getsockname()
 
 (2) ... встроенная функция gethostbyname()
 
 (3) ... встроенная функция getpeername()
 
Номер 2
Для определения доменного имени компьютера по IP-адресу служит...
Ответ:
 (1) ... встроенная функция getsockname()
 
 (2) ... встроенная функция gethostbyname()
 
 (3) ... встроенная функция gethostbyaddr()
 
Номер 3
Проверить работоспособность хоста по его IP-адресу можно...
Ответ:
 (1) ... встроенной функцией ping()
 
 (2) ... методом ping()
из класса Net::Ping
 
 (3) ... методом ping()
из класса IO::Socket
 
Упражнение 6:
Номер 1
Что такое протокол в сетевом программировании?
Ответ:
 (1) правила для согласованного взаимодействия при обмене данными 
 (2) регистрация действий программы в файле 
 (3) логический канал связи между сетевыми программами 
Номер 2
Что такое сокет в сетевом программировании?
Ответ:
 (1) это уникальный адрес компьютера в сети  
 (2) логический канал связи между сетевыми программами 
 (3) специальный блок данных для передачи информации по сети  
Номер 3
Что такое пакет в сетевом программировании?
Ответ:
 (1) специальный блок данных для передачи информации по сети 
 (2) логический канал связи между сетевыми программами 
 (3) совокупность информации, передаваемой по сети